Annual
The classic Mexican herb used in salsas. Also popular in Asian cooking. Slow to bolt (blossom), but after it does, leaf production goes down. Will re-seed itself if you let some flowers go.

Your cilantro starts are in a 6-pot pack for easier planting. There are 2 to 4 plants per pot for plentiful harvests!

Cilantro is a short lived herb and needs to be replanted if you want to have it all summer long. Some people use transplants for the first batch, and then buy seeds for subsequent plantings during the summer.
